Folio from the Bhaktamara Stotra (“Hymn of the Immortal Devotee”) is an unspecified by Unknown, held at Detroit Institute of Arts.
This painting depicts a serene scene with a central figure seated cross-legged on a red throne, surrounded by a red archway. The figure is adorned in a simple orange robe, and its hands are placed in its lap. To the left, a smaller figure is shown sitting on a red cushion, with its hands clasped together in prayer. The background features a blue sky with white clouds. In the foreground, several figures are engaged in various activities. Some are shown bowing or kneeling, while others are depicted in the water, accompanied by fish. The overall atmosphere of the painting exudes a sense of reverence and devotion.
